如何用python计算数据库

如何用python计算数据库

作者:William Gu发布时间:2026-01-14阅读时长:0 分钟阅读次数:4

用户关注问题

Q
Python如何连接数据库进行计算操作?

我想用Python访问数据库并执行一些计算相关的查询,应该如何开始?需要哪些库?

A

使用Python连接数据库并执行计算查询的步骤

你可以使用Python中的数据库驱动库例如sqlite3、PyMySQL、psycopg2等来连接相应的数据库。连接数据库后,通过执行SQL语句,可以进行数据的查询和计算操作。通常你需要先建立数据库连接,创建游标,然后使用游标执行SQL计算相关操作的语句,最后获取结果。

Q
用Python处理数据库中的数据计算时,有哪些常见的注意事项?

在用Python对数据库数据进行计算处理时,可能会遇到什么问题,需要注意什么?

A

Python处理数据库数据计算时的注意点

需要注意数据类型匹配和SQL注入风险。查询结果的数据类型应符合Python计算需求,必要时进行类型转换。另外,使用参数化查询可以避免SQL注入攻击。此外,要及时关闭数据库连接避免资源泄露,同时考虑数据量较大时的性能优化。

Q
Python中如何使用pandas结合数据库数据进行复杂计算?

如果数据库中有数据,我想用pandas进行更复杂的数据计算和分析,怎么操作?

A

用pandas从数据库导入数据并进行计算分析的方法

可以利用pandas的read_sql()函数直接从数据库读取表或查询结果到DataFrame中。这样你就能使用pandas强大的数据处理和计算功能实现复杂分析。需要先创建数据库连接对象,然后将SQL查询语句和连接对象传入read_sql函数,获得DataFrame后即可进行计算操作。